Buy tickets from Cardiff Queen Street
through Realtime Tickets, our new ticket portal
2112
Cardiff Central
On time
Transport for Wales · 3 coaches
3
2112
Pontypridd
On time
Transport for Wales · 2 coaches
4
2119
Rhymney
Bus service
Transport for Wales service
2120
Cardiff Bay
On time
Transport for Wales · 2 coaches
2
2122
Coryton
On time
Transport for Wales · 2 coaches
4
2129
Penarth
On time
Transport for Wales · 2 coaches
2
2132
Cardiff Bay
Starts here
Transport for Wales · 2 coaches
1
2134
Merthyr Tydfil
On time
Transport for Wales · 4 coaches
4
2137
Aberdare
On time
Transport for Wales · 4 coaches
2
2138
Cardiff Central
Bus service
Transport for Wales service
2142
Cardiff Central
On time
Transport for Wales · 4 coaches
3
2142
Pontypridd
On time
Transport for Wales · 2 coaches
4
2149
Rhymney
Bus service
Transport for Wales service
2150
Cardiff Bay
On time
Transport for Wales · 2 coaches
2
2152
Coryton
On time
Transport for Wales · 2 coaches
4
2158
Penarth
On time
Transport for Wales · 2 coaches
2
2202
Cardiff Bay
Starts here
Transport for Wales · 2 coaches
1
2204
Cardiff Central
On time
Transport for Wales · 4 coaches
3
2204
Treherbert
On time
Transport for Wales · 4 coaches
4
2208
Cardiff Central
Bus service
Transport for Wales service
2212
Cardiff Central
On time
Transport for Wales · 4 coaches
3
2212
Pontypridd
On time
Transport for Wales · 2 coaches
4
2219
Rhymney
Bus service
Transport for Wales service
2220
Cardiff Bay
On time
Transport for Wales · 2 coaches
2
2222
Coryton
On time
Transport for Wales · 2 coaches
4
2226
Cardiff Central
On time
Transport for Wales · 2 coaches
2
2232
Cardiff Bay
Starts here
Transport for Wales · 2 coaches
1
2234
Merthyr Tydfil
On time
Transport for Wales · 4 coaches
4
2235
Aberdare
On time
Transport for Wales · 4 coaches
2
2238
Cardiff Central
Bus service
Transport for Wales service
2242
Pontypridd
On time
Transport for Wales · 2 coaches
4
2249
Rhymney
Bus service
Transport for Wales service
2250
Cardiff Bay
On time
Transport for Wales · 2 coaches
2
2302
Cardiff Bay
Starts here
Transport for Wales · 2 coaches
1
2303
Penarth
On time
Transport for Wales · 2 coaches
2
2304
Treherbert
On time
Transport for Wales · 4 coaches
4